Make My Day, Inc.
Make My Day offers an in-car driving assistance app for optimizing driving in electric cars. Its features for an in car Driving Assistance connects the driver with the car while doing extra activities. It also connects drivers to business providers and gives them a full range solution for the daily needs. Make My Day is based in Tel-Aviv, Israel.

Make My Day, Inc. has raised $4.3M across 1 round. Its most recent round was a Venture - Series Unknown of $4.3M in Dec 2021. Full funding history, investors, and team are detailed below.
